HOW TO BECOME A BETTER BLOGGER Five Great Ideas Here From Guest Blogger Rochelle Melander   I love watching talent competition shows like American Idol. I notice that the best performers make singing look easy. Yet I know that many hours of practice support every single note.  Because blogging is such an immediate experience, with posts responding to recent events, it appears easier than, say, writing a book. Yet hours of practice, study, writing, and revising makes the best bloggers stand out from the crowd. Here’s how to develop a winning blogging style:    (1) Research The Medium   Blogs are not periodicals or newspapers. They look different. The articles need to sound different and still offer great content. You need to learn the form instead of trying to squeeze your white paper writing style into a blog post. Know how the best blogs write: first person perspective, shorter posts, the best information at the beginning of the post, valuable content throughout the post, links to other information and blogs, and photos.    (2) Sharpen Your Voice   Read a few of your posts aloud. Does your unique personality come through in the writing? If not, keep writing and revising until your posts sound like you. Pro tip: people like you and want to read your work both because you have something valuable to say but also because of how you say it. Think about how your unique perspective, including your quirks and pet peeves, comes through in your writing.    (3) Create Great Content   Blogs need to provide valuable or fun information to the lives of others....

GUEST BLOG YOUR WAY TO SUCCESS Social Media Rockstar Tip By Karen Repoli    Sharing your knowledge on other peoples sites is actually a fantastic strategy to help your build your own brand. That means making sure that you create and maintain active (and mutually beneficial) relationships with influencers in your field of expertise and add value to their community. In return they will usually allow you to place links to your material at the bottom of your articles and they will share them with their “TRIBE” on Social Media. Classic “WIN/WIN” How Often Should You Post?    Ideally, you should be writing something everyday or so, but if article writing is not a passion of yours, make that “as often as possible”. There are other ways to contribute as well of course (Podcasts - Videos - etc) but article writing is still a great strategy for building authority. Don’t underestimate the power of regularity here as an effective part of your guest blogging strategy. Simply do as much as you can as often as you can. It all helps!! BUILD YOUR BRAND WITH GUEST BLOGGING Fantastic Guest Blog Here From Ann Smarty The concept of spending time and effort to write for someone else for free may seem weird: Many bloggers don’t like the idea of not being paid for such an effort. However we have seen so many people building up their startups and income thanks to writing for other sites that Guest writing is a crucial tool for any kind of professional online activity. Some of the ways it can be used are: Gaining traffic to your own website, whether a blog or a company site. Sharing content with a wider audience. Finding a new reader pool to dip into. Branding yourself as an expert in your field, by solidifying your authority. Publishing samples around the web to get you consulting or freelancing work later on. Possibly gaining attention from major media sources by piggy-backing on a more popular site. Building relationships with important industry contacts. Spreading your wings and showing your chops in a new niche. Trading posts with other bloggers/writers to diversify your own blog content for free. As you can see, the applications of this technique are pretty broad, and there are many benefits. How To Get Started The process can actually be broken down into steps. Step One - Isolate Your Niche You know those dozen things you know a lot about? Don’t go jumping into them all at once. You should be isolating the niche that you want to focus on, and become an authority there, first. So select a category that you most want to be known for. Then break...

THE POWER OF GUEST BLOGGING Guest post creation for blogging means that a writer submits an article to someone else’s blog. So essentially you are a “guest” of the blog you are sending your article to. The key points to remember for guest blogging is to look for a blog that matches your article and your website’s topic.   Getting Clear In Guest Blogging   So for instance if you write about niche markets anything from finding them to monetizing them one you’ll have a variety of blogs to ask if they would like to post your article on their blog. By posting your blog on another person’s website you are now exposing your writing to a new audience. That is achieved because you will have at least one link back to your website in your signature. Those new readers have a choice to go over to your blog and check that out. Who knows you may even gain a few new readers in the process. Using another analogy; if you have a finance website then obviously you would look to send your article to another finance type blog. That would include blogs on saving money, blogs on investing  money, blogs with advice geared to the Millennials etc. What if you have a topic for your blog that doesn’t seem to match any other blog? The best advice is to see how your article can best match the blog you are submitting to by using a different point of view or perspective. I think the best way to demonstrate this would be if you have an energy blog you can write an article about energy saving tips that help you save money on your bill.
